Psychological Testing of Hispanics concentrates on two main themes: differential psychology and psychological testing in the specific context of testing Hispanics. This book presents an integration of these themes toward the goal of understanding the test performance of Hispanics while emphasizing the proper use of psychological tests. In this text, psychometric issues are discussed as central to the understanding of psychological testing. Psychological Testing of Hispanics reviews social policy and legal issues including the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ission's guidelines that were intended to balance psychometrics and social policy concerns.
This softcover edition is a re-release of the 1992 hardcover edition.
This book is part of the APA Science Volume Series.
